Output 578260a359cc2ebda73c73f85293854fe63fb92aebe463ebb028db350c89566b:7

value
50563
script pubkey
OP_0 OP_PUSHBYTES_20 610d052f44bd2dc1b324652ca7f78de178335b03
address
bc1qvyxs2t6yh5kurveyv5k20audu9urxkcreefjs0
transaction
578260a359cc2ebda73c73f85293854fe63fb92aebe463ebb028db350c89566b
confirmations
166869
spent
true